Spectra and symmetry in nuclear pairing

Description

We apply the algebraic Bethe ansatz technique to the nuclear pairing problem with orbit dependent coupling constants and degenerate single particle energy levels. We find the exact energies and eigenstates. We show that for a given shell, there are degeneracies between the states corresponding to less than and more than half full shell. We also provide a technique to solve the equations of Bethe ansatz
